On average across the year,
yes, Barbados is hotter than
Fresno, California
.
Barbados has an average temperature of 27°C/81°F and Fresno, California has an average temperature of 19°C/66°F.
Barbados's hottest month is May, with an average maximum temperature of 31°C/88°F, which is not hotter than Fresno, California's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 38°C/100°F).
On average across the year, no, Barbados is not colder than Fresno, California . Barbados has an average minimum temperature of 24°C/75°F and Fresno, California has an average minimum temperature of 12°C/54°F.
On average across the year,
yes, Barbados has more rain than
Fresno, California. Barbados has an average annual rainfall of 444mm and Fresno, California has an average annual rainfall of 267mm.
Barbados's wettest month is August, with an average monthly rainfall of 98mm, which is wetter than Fresno, California's wettest month (January, with an average monthly rainfall of 56mm).
